|
| FreeBSD partitions-problemer Fra : Christian Bruhn Gufl~ |
Dato : 19-02-01 08:27 |
|
Jeg var så fiks at oprette en ny partition på min HD, hvilket (selvfølgelig)
resulterede i at FreeBSD ikke kan mounte sine standarder (/usr /var) da den
tror de ligger som partition 2 - men de er i virkeligheden part. 3.
Efter boot får jeg en slags single-user adgang, hvor mange programmer ikke
virker (vi etc.)
Hvordan fikses det ??
MVH
Christian Gufler
| |
Mads Hugo Pedersen (19-02-2001)
| Kommentar Fra : Mads Hugo Pedersen |
Dato : 19-02-01 10:45 |
|
On Mon, 19 Feb 2001, Christian Bruhn Gufler uttered the following:
> Jeg var så fiks at oprette en ny partition på min HD, hvilket
> (selvfølgelig) resulterede i at FreeBSD ikke kan mounte sine
> standarder (/usr /var) da den tror de ligger som partition 2 - men de
> er i virkeligheden part. 3.
>
> Efter boot får jeg en slags single-user adgang, hvor mange programmer
> ikke virker (vi etc.)
>
> Hvordan fikses det ??
Grunden til at du ikke kan bruge vi er at din disk er mountet read-only
i single-user. Kør "mount -u /" for at mounte dit / filsystem
read-write. Derefter kan du rette i din /etc/fstab så dine partitions
oplysninger passer.
/M@ds
--
UNIX is user friendly.
It's just selective about who its friends are.
| |
Ole Hansen (19-02-2001)
| Kommentar Fra : Ole Hansen |
Dato : 19-02-01 10:49 |
|
Christian Bruhn Gufler wrote:
>
> Jeg var så fiks at oprette en ny partition på min HD, hvilket (selvfølgelig)
> resulterede i at FreeBSD ikke kan mounte sine standarder (/usr /var) da den
> tror de ligger som partition 2 - men de er i virkeligheden part. 3.
Du skal have fat i /etc/fstab og aendre den, saa den stemmer overens med
"virkeligheden". Eventuelt kan du bede fdisk fortaelle dig hvad dine
slices (er det ikke det, det hedder i *BSD?) hedder..
> Efter boot får jeg en slags single-user adgang, hvor mange programmer ikke
> virker (vi etc.)
Uha, ingen vi? Uhmm.. Der er da vist en eller anden virkelig minimal
editor med FreeBSD der kan koere "altid" er der ikke?
> MVH
> Christian Gufler
--
Ole Hansen
| |
Mads Hugo Pedersen (19-02-2001)
| Kommentar Fra : Mads Hugo Pedersen |
Dato : 19-02-01 12:47 |
|
On Mon, 19 Feb 2001, Ole Hansen uttered the following:
>> Efter boot får jeg en slags single-user adgang, hvor mange programmer
>> ikke virker (vi etc.)
>
> Uha, ingen vi? Uhmm.. Der er da vist en eller anden virkelig minimal
> editor med FreeBSD der kan koere "altid" er der ikke?
vi er med per default, problemet var at disken ikke var mountet rw og
derfor kan vi ikke skrive til disken.
/M@ds
--
There is a low, deep rumbling sound in the distance.
I believe it is the sound of Penguins on the march...
| |
Christian Bruhn Gufl~ (19-02-2001)
| Kommentar Fra : Christian Bruhn Gufl~ |
Dato : 19-02-01 11:34 |
|
Takker for svarene, løder meget rimeligt.
MVH
Christian Gufler
"Christian Bruhn Gufler" <cbg@mfd.dk> skrev i en meddelelse
news:3a90cc1d$0$10114$4d4eb98e@news.dk.uu.net...
> Jeg var så fiks at oprette en ny partition på min HD, hvilket
(selvfølgelig)
> resulterede i at FreeBSD ikke kan mounte sine standarder (/usr /var) da
den
> tror de ligger som partition 2 - men de er i virkeligheden part. 3.
>
> Efter boot får jeg en slags single-user adgang, hvor mange programmer ikke
> virker (vi etc.)
>
> Hvordan fikses det ??
>
> MVH
> Christian Gufler
>
>
| |
Jesper Skriver (19-02-2001)
| Kommentar Fra : Jesper Skriver |
Dato : 19-02-01 22:14 |
|
On Mon, 19 Feb 2001 08:27:02 +0100, Christian Bruhn Gufler wrote:
>Jeg var så fiks at oprette en ny partition på min HD, hvilket (selvfølgelig)
>resulterede i at FreeBSD ikke kan mounte sine standarder (/usr /var) da den
>tror de ligger som partition 2 - men de er i virkeligheden part. 3.
>
>Efter boot får jeg en slags single-user adgang, hvor mange programmer ikke
>virker (vi etc.)
>
>Hvordan fikses det ??
mount -o rw -u /
mount -o rw /dev/da0s3d /var
mount -o rw /dev/da0s3e /usr
Antager at dine devices hedder ovenstående, ellers retter du dem bare, efter
det kan du bruge vi til et rettet /etc/fstab
--
Jesper Skriver, CCIE #5456
| |
Christian Bruhn Gufl~ (21-02-2001)
| Kommentar Fra : Christian Bruhn Gufl~ |
Dato : 21-02-01 15:09 |
|
Som beskrevet er min root-partition read-only, og jeg kan trods de gode
forslag ikke mounte den om, vi er rent faktisk ikke tilstede, idet det
ligger i en partition (/usr) der ikke kan mountes for jeg har lavet nodes
til den (MAKEDEV) og det kan jeg ikke før jeg har skriveret til root (/dev)
Den eneste måde jeg har kunnet mounte alt er ved at boote fa en 4.2
installations CD (image fra freebsd.org), og så manuelt mounte drevene (kan
kun gøres relativt til /mnt) og her er der lavet korrekte nodes (ad0s3a ->
ad0s3f)
alt afhængigt af hvornår jeg at boote (loader / boot2) hedder min root
wd0s3a
ad0s3a
Hvad nu ??
MVH
Christian Gufler
| |
|
|